1.1.5

.. _Release Notes_1.1.5_New Features:

New Features

  • Add bake() method to HTTPServer for creating pre-configured request expectation proxies (BakedHTTPServer). This allows sharing common keyword arguments (e.g. method, headers) across multiple expect_request() calls with last-wins merging semantics.
